§ 24-51-1511 — Limitation on actions by eligible employees

Administrative
actions or civil actions brought by employees to dispute the election for
participation or failure to elect participation in the association's defined benefit
plan, the association's defined contribution plan, or the defined contribution plan
established pursuant to part 2 of article 52 of this title, as said article existed prior
to its repeal in 2009, shall commence within one hundred eighty days after the
election or within one hundred eighty days of the last day on which the employee
may make an election to participate in such plan pursuant to this article and article
52 of this title, whichever is earlier, and not thereafter.

Legislative History
Source: L. 2006: Entire section added, p. 1190, � 26, effective May 25. L.
2009: Entire section amended, (SB 09-066), ch. 73, p. 254, � 13, effective March 31.
